谷歌云翻译在Python中的应用越来越广泛,本文将带你了解如何使用谷歌云翻译API进行文本翻译,并在Python项目中集成这一功能。
什么是谷歌云翻译API
谷歌云翻译API是一种机器翻译服务,可以实现将一种语言翻译成另一种语言的功能。通过谷歌云翻译API,开发者可以轻松实现文本翻译功能,帮助用户跨越语言障碍。
如何使用谷歌云翻译API
使用谷歌云翻译API需要先创建一个谷歌云账号,并设置好付费方式。接下来,你需要创建一个新的项目并启用谷歌云翻译API。获得API密钥后,你就可以在Python项目中开始调用API进行翻译。
步骤一:安装Google Cloud Translation API Python客户端库
在Python中使用谷歌云翻译API需要安装相应的客户端库。你可以通过pip安装google-cloud-translate
库: bash c pip install google-cloud-translate
步骤二:调用API进行翻译
在Python代码中,你可以通过简单的几行代码调用谷歌云翻译API实现文本翻译。以下是一个示例: python from google.cloud import translate_v2
def translate_text(text, target_language): translate_client = translate_v2.Client() result = translate_client.translate(text, target_language=target_language) return result[‘translatedText’]
text = ‘Hello, world!’ target_language = ‘zh’ translated_text = translate_text(text, target_language) print(translated_text)
常见问题FAQ
如何获得谷歌云翻译API密钥?
要获得谷歌云翻译API密钥,你需要先在谷歌云控制台中创建一个新项目并启用翻译API。接着在API管理界面申请API密钥即可。
谷歌云翻译API支持哪些语言?
谷歌云翻译API支持超过 a hundred 种语言,包括世界各地常用的语言以及一些少数民族语言。
谷歌云翻译API收费吗?
是的,谷歌云翻译API是按字符数进行计费的,具体收费标准可以在谷歌云平台上查看。